1. Layered Textiles

Layering is the cornerstone of a boho chic aesthetic, adding depth, warmth, and an inviting sense of coziness to your bedroom. Start with your bedding by mixing and matching textures such as crisp cotton sheets, chunky knit blankets, and woven throws. Don’t shy away from patterns—think global-inspired prints or vintage florals. Extend the layering to the floor with multiple rugs that complement but don’t match exactly, creating a laid-back yet intentional look.

2. Natural Materials

Natural and sustainable materials are hallmarks of boho decor, bringing an earthy and grounded feel to your space. Look for furniture made of rattan, wicker, or reclaimed wood, and accessorize with bamboo blinds or woven baskets. These elements not only add texture but also connect your bedroom to nature in an organic way.

3. Indoor Plants

No boho bedroom is complete without a touch of greenery. Plants bring life and freshness into your space, whether you opt for vibrant, leafy pothos or low-maintenance succulents. Play with scale by combining small potted plants on shelves with larger floor plants in woven baskets.

4. Soft Lighting

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the mood of your boho sanctuary. Layer your lighting with a mix of string lights, paper lanterns, and vintage-style lamps. Choose warm-toned bulbs to create a soft, inviting glow that transforms your bedroom into a calming retreat.

5. Eclectic Wall Decor

Your walls are a canvas for your creativity. Boho style thrives on eclectic and personalized decor, so mix and match framed art, macrame hangings, and decorative mirrors. Consider incorporating thrifted or DIY pieces to add a layer of authenticity to your space.

7. Layered Rugs

Layering rugs is an art form that adds texture, warmth, and visual interest to your bedroom. Experiment with different patterns, materials, and sizes to create a look that’s uniquely yours. Pair a bold, colorful rug with a neutral jute base for a balanced yet dynamic effect.
